BET Ends “Rap City” and change it to “The Deal”
Black Entertainment Television (BET) announced last September 30 that the most popular rap music video program Rap City. BET has announced the official word on their website.
According to their Sound off blog, “Rap City” will be replaced by “The Deal” hosted by DJ Diamond Kutz.
“The Deal” will consist of old and new elemenets from “Rap City“. Hip-Hop videos will continue to play but now they will be accompanied by pop-ups with facts on the given artist/songs and the booth which is the trademark of “Rap City” for artist to showcase their freestyle skills will still remain in “The Deal“.
“Rap City” is more than just a place for hip-hop videos, Rap City gave fame to several host, like Chris Thomas, Hans Dobson, Prince Dejour and Joe Clair and Leslie Segar (a.k.a “Big Lez“)
“The Deal” premieres on Bet on November 10th.
